During the 2020-2021 academic year, Saint Mary-of-the-Woods College handed out 5 bachelor's degrees in general health & wellness. This is an increase of 67% over the previous year when 3 degrees were handed out.

SMWC General Health & Wellness Bachelor’s Program

All of the 5 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in health and wellness from SMWC in 2021 were women.

undefined

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at SMWC are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 80% of students fell into this category.
